IT ANALYST IPOSITION OVERVIEW:The IT Analyst I is an entry-level technical position responsible for providing technology support, triage, configuration, testing and maintenance for the specified applications or services to the designated business owners within Versant Power.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
Monitors and maintains all operational processing as prescribed by the respective application business areas. Reports on anomalies and works with intermediate and senior technicians to resolve problems.
Supports the development and testing of new applications, application changes, and upgrades associated with the specified applications and related integration tools, as specified and designed by the intermediate and senior level analysts.
Provide secondary testing and documentation for proposed solutions before moving to production.
Aids internal customers by providing data analyses, problem analysis, testing analysis and problem resolution.
Research and recreate system issues submitted by internal customers to determine cause of issue.
Work with external vendors to resolve system issues as needed.
Works with internal customers to modify and update business processes as needed to support evolving business requirements.
Work with internal customers to determine steps followed when issue occurred.
Work with internal customers to determine system or process improvements.
Create system use instructions for internal customers when new features are added.
Provide training for internal customers on new features/functionality as needed.
Assists in training new department members.
Helps intermediate and senior level resources to learn new skills and help cover support for other application systems.
Supports, tests, configures and troubleshoots for Customer Information Systems (CIS)
Provides necessary backup to single points of failure in Production Operations as assigned.
Provides documentation to support the department's work plan as assigned.
Participates, as required, in additional duties as assigned.
Assist with special projects as requested based on business or system knowledge.
Work with external vendors to resolve outstanding system issues.
Create Oracle views to gather specific data from multiple tables to support internal customer requests.
Assist in gathering external customer data to create mail merges.
Complies with internal audit requirements, test policies and change control processes.
Works in accordance with the documented environmental procedures, instructions, and specific responsibilities as defined in individual procedures and instructions. Reports problems or deviations associated with environmental issues and the Environmental Management System (EMS) to the Environmental Department.
QUALIFICATIONS:
AS in Computer Science or equivalent experience required.
Minimum of 6 months experience in a client-focused IT support role preferred.
Exposure to testing methodologies required.
Strong customer service ethics, and the ability to work independently or in teams.
Excellent written and oral communication skills.
Exposure to utility application systems, billing systems and/or electrical infrastructure and design preferred.
Must be willing to travel for training.
Position requires a valid driver’s license.
IT ANALYST IIThe IT Analyst II is an intermediate technical position responsible for support, maintenance, design and development for assigned Versant Power Information Systems.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Supports the design, development and testing of new applications, application changes, and upgrades associated with the specified applications and related integration tools.
Provides technical support, maintenance, development, programming and troubleshooting for Customer Information System (CIS) and the integration with other systems.
Expertise and experience in the following: SQL
Provide assistance to internal customers by providing reports, queries, data analyses, problem analysis and problem resolution.
Supports synchronization of data between GIS/CIS/AMI/MDM.
Develops and maintains necessary working relationships with external service providers, vendors and other support personnel to resolve issues and ensure efficient operations.
Provides documentation/project tracking and management reporting to support the department's work plan.
Provides technical information for Disaster Recovery planning and participates in annual Technical Asset Review updates to help ensure asset life cycle management.
Complies with internal audit requirements, test policies and change control processes.
Actively participates in CIS Team meetings and contributes to the decision-making processes.
Participates in after-hours call out for application support.
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ned by supervisor or management.
IT ANALYST IIIIT Analyst III is a senior technical position responsible for support, maintenance, design and development for assigned Versant Power Information Systems.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Identify, troubleshoot, resolve systems issues and optimize performance of applications to insure critical business processes function as needed.
Supports internal customers by providing reports, queries, and data analyses.
Performs analysis of complex problems and implements resolutions in order to maintain system functionality and avoid service disruptions.
Develops, codes, implements, modifies, and troubleshoots system integrations.
Configures and implements API calls or requests between multiple software systems.
Works with complex XML and flat file data integrations.
Supports the design, development and testing of application changes, upgrades and related integration tools.
Develops and maintains necessary relationships with business stakeholders, external service providers, vendors and other support personnel to resolve issues and ensure efficient operations.
Works with vendors to ensure the vendor understands Versant Power’s business practices and Versant Power’s relationships with other products and technology.
Acts as a liaison for the technical team to project leadership teams and management and advises all levels of leadership in technical decision-making.
Develops and mentors’ co-workers to encourage growth and covers support for gaps in the department as needed.
Completes and monitors routine daily application support tasks and completes analysis and resolution of abnormal system activity.
Actively contributes to IT strategic planning and asset management by raising concerns about infrastructure limitations and design capacities, by participating in assessment and lifecycle planning efforts, by suggesting improvements and extension opportunities for maximum asset value realization.
Provides documentation/project tracking and management reporting to support the department's work plan.
Responsible for application DR (Disaster Recovery) planning and conducts annual Technology Asset Reviews (TAR).
Complies with internal audit requirements, test policies and change control processes and assists in audit processes by providing data, meeting with auditors, and any other audit tasks as needed.
Maintains knowledge and understanding of existing and emerging technology related to information technologies used at Versant Power and Electric Utilities and operating in a State regulated environment.
Participates in after-hours call out for application support.
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ned by supervisor or management.
